Transaction 77a3386c2672709d5488d17e09dde0b8c7dd10f4e24e1daff69742316e10c79e

1 Input
2 Outputs
  • 77a3386c2672709d5488d17e09dde0b8c7dd10f4e24e1daff69742316e10c79e:0
  • value  2012917
    address  1PwNZdRnvFQrxAgW3coonQ62jZhrzRZCfi
  • 77a3386c2672709d5488d17e09dde0b8c7dd10f4e24e1daff69742316e10c79e:1
  • value  16236859
    address  bc1q4zvrcfqpk7e963lvuef9q9h80rjp9v2zueeplc